Scottish Championship Updates
Luthee13:
Andrew Peter T Grant pushes and gets a call from Conghai Wang.
Andrew has Ac 3c
Conghai has 10d 10s
A very interesting flop of 6c Jc 4s brings hope to Andrew with a flush draw and straight possibilities.
The turn 3s takes the straight option out but adds other outs
The river did not want to help and the 10h sees Conghai make a set and sends Andrew to the rail in 16th place.
We are hand for hand now as we are on the money bubble - good luck to all.
Luthee13:
The very next hand sees David James Clarke create some debate and thinking. He pushes all in after a raise by Nicki Seton and is flat called by the significantly larger stack of Liam Spence. After much thought, Nicki folds.
David shows Jc Jd
Liam shows Ks Kh
The flop leaves David wanting as it falls 5c Ks 7s - he needs running clubs to avoid being the bubble boy...
The 3h on the turn leaves him drawing dead and the A s on the river is irrelevant, David is sent to the rail in 15th place.
The remaining players are all in the money, congratulations to them :)
IrishTom:
Having just doubled up to 44k, Judith Davidson ships it all in with 9s 9h against Tom Clark"s Qd Ks
Flop 5d 5s 2s and Tom stands up...
Turn 7d
River Qs
Tom scoops and sends Judith to the Rail in 14 spot for a min cash of £150
